Al Ahly head coach Pitso Mosimane says his side will continue to fight to retain their Egyptian Premier League title following their stalemate against National Bank SC.

The Red Eagles were forced to settle for a point after playing out to a 1-1 draw with National Bank at the Al Ahly Al Salam Stadium on Thursday evening.

Afsha broke the deadlock from Ahly in the 47th minute but Karim Bambo’s equaliser earned National Bank SC a point five minutes before full time.

Mosimane’s side remain second in the league standings with 52 points after 24 games, eight points behind log-leaders Zamalek. Ahly, though, have three games in hand due to their participation in the Caf Champions League.

“We will fight for the league title,” Mosimane told his club’s official website.

“We have mistakes and we have to correct them. We did not play well and I am disappointed with my team and myself.

“We had several chances in the first half, but we failed to convert them. Football always punishes you when you do not take the chances.

“If I want to find an easy way out, I will say absences, but I am not the type of coach who looks for excuses. We knew from the beginning that we will miss players.
